Sean Dyche is among the front runners to take over from Frank Lampard as Everton manager this month after the Toffees sacked Lampard – and Carlo Ancelotti gave his verdict on Dyche’s style of play at Burnley, back in March 2021.

Dyche, 51, has been out of work since being sacked by Burnley in April 2022. The Clarets were then relegated, while Dyche is still looking for a new home. He is now approaching a year out of football, but he is a contender for Everton.

The Sun report that Dyche is very interested in a move to become Everton manager. Lampard was sacked earlier this week, after a dismal 2-0 loss to West Ham on the weekend. The Toffees currently sit in a woeful 19th in the League.

Speaking on Dyche and his style of play, then-Everton manager Ancelotti was very complimentary. He said he had been brought up on the 4-4-2 formation. Not only did Ancelotti praise Dyche’s style, but says he is a “good guy”.

“I like their style of play. Because they play clear 4-4-2. I was born 4-4-2 with [Arrigo] Sacchi as player and assistant. [Dyche] is a good guy. We have spent some time before games. I respect the style of play of Burnley. I like it a lot”.

Is Dyche the man Everton fans want? Reaction on social media seems like a mixed one. Everton are in real trouble and Dyche would sort the Toffees out defensively. He would make them hard to beat – before focusing on the attack.

He would reunite with James Tarkowski and use that as a base to progress defensively. Dyche would also have Dwight McNeil out wide and could get the best out of him. McNeil has struggled at Everton since his move from Burnley.
